Skip to content

MOTOR MOUNT STAND OFFS

SKU RLC478LSTO
Sold out
Original price $22.23 - Original price $22.23
Original price $22.23
$22.23
$22.23 - $22.23
Current price $22.23
MOTOR MOUNT STAND OFFS